IPOH: An elderly man has been missing for over 48 hours now since he went hiking near a hill at Puncak Jelapang here on Friday (March 11) evening.

Ipoh OCPD Asst Comm Yahaya Hassan said the search and rescue teams were looking for Lau San, 84, who was reported missing by friends after the hiking trip at about 6.30pm.

“Canine units and drones from the police and Fire and Rescue Department have been deployed to look for Lau,” said ACP Yahaya on Sunday .Aside from the police and firemen, the search and rescue operation also consists of personnel from the Civil Defence Department and Special Malaysia Disaster Assistance and Rescue Team.

ACP Yahaya said the public are reminded to always take care of their own safety as well as other group members while carrying out high-risk leisure activities like hill climbing or hiking.“They should also never leave their friends alone under any circumstances when going in groups,” he said, adding that the people should call 999 immediately for emergencies.

“The people should always bring along their mobile phones and ensure that these are adequately charged,” he said.
